What are the steps in tissue preperation?
Fixation, Processing, Embedding, Sectioning, Staining
What fixes everything?
Formalin 10% buffered
What is the usual stain?
H&E
hemotoxylin and eosin
What are special stains used for?
For special tissues and if you are looking for something specific
What kind of microscopy do we usually use?
Light microscopy
